Federal Judiciary Marks Building Milestone
Construction of the Thurgood Marshall Federal Judiciary Building (TMFJB), began in April 1990 and
was completed by the original target day of October 1, 1992. “To American citizens, [the building] helps put a
face on a branch of government that is spread out across the nation, and serves as a strong testament to the
important work that is accomplished here,” Administrative Office of the U.S. Courts Director Leonidas Ralph
Mecham said in commemorating the anniversary of the TMFJB.
